コミットメタ情報

リビジョン1763752c2d1ada9d19df6b15b9b7ba7951352b09 (tree)
日時2018-04-03 22:21:37
作者Kazuhiro Fujieda <fujieda@user...>
コミッターKazuhiro Fujieda

ログメッセージ

対空砲火における装備の効果を最新の検証結果に合わせる

変更サマリ

差分

--- a/KancolleSniffer/ItemInfo.cs
+++ b/KancolleSniffer/ItemInfo.cs
@@ -520,11 +520,11 @@ namespace KancolleSniffer
520520 case 15: // 機銃
521521 return 6 * Spec.AntiAir + 4 * Sqrt(Level);
522522 case 16: // 高角砲
523- return 4 * Spec.AntiAir + 3 * Sqrt(Level);
523+ return 4 * Spec.AntiAir + (Spec.AntiAir >= 8 ? 3 : 2) * Sqrt(Level);
524524 case 11: // 電探
525525 return 3 * Spec.AntiAir;
526526 case 30: // 高射装置
527- return 4 * Spec.AntiAir;
527+ return 4 * Spec.AntiAir + 2 * Sqrt(Level);
528528 }
529529 return 0;
530530 }
@@ -549,10 +549,12 @@ namespace KancolleSniffer
549549 case 12: // 三式弾
550550 return 0.6 * Spec.AntiAir;
551551 case 16: // 高角砲
552- return 0.35 * Spec.AntiAir + 3 * Sqrt(Level);
552+ return 0.35 * Spec.AntiAir + (Spec.AntiAir >= 8 ? 3 : 2) * Sqrt(Level);
553553 case 30: // 高射装置
554- return 0.35 * Spec.AntiAir;
554+ return 0.35 * Spec.AntiAir + 2 * Sqrt(Level);
555555 default:
556+ if (Spec.Id == 9) // 46cm三連装砲
557+ return 0.25 * Spec.AntiAir;
556558 if (Spec.Type == 10) // 水偵
557559 return 0.2 * Spec.AntiAir;
558560 break;
旧リポジトリブラウザで表示